Didcot Parkway to Wylde Green by train

A train trip from Didcot Parkway to Wylde Green takes about 2hrs 18 mins on average, covering roughly 69 miles (111 kilometres). With around 20 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£21.40,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Didcot Parkway to Wylde Green start from as little as £21.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Didcot Parkway to Wylde Green start from £59.00 one way, or £60.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Didcot Parkway to Wylde Green are available for £63.40 one way, or £124.40 return

Facilities and Amenities at Didcot Parkway

Didcot Parkway is well-suited to serve as a vital transit point with comprehensive facilities. The station operates with a dedicated ticket office open from early morning to late evening, while ticket machines provide additional convenience for buying and collecting pre-purchased tickets. Accessibility is a key feature at Didcot Parkway. The station ensures step-free access to all platforms, complemented by lifts, although travelers should be cautious as there is no tactile paving at the platform edges.

For travelers in need of assistance, help is readily available via customer service points and staff assistance available on most days from 5 AM to midnight. While the station accommodates various needs, including accessible seating areas and waiting rooms on platforms 1, 3, and 5, it does lack accessible toilets. However, standard toilets and baby changing facilities are available on Platform 3, ensuring a level of comfort is maintained for many travelers.

Dining and Shopping at the Station

For those who wish to grab a bite or need to stock up on essentials, the station has a Spar supermarket and coffee shops. An ATM machine is available in the Spar shop with potential charges, ensuring you’re never caught short on your travels. While currency exchange services are not provided, you’ll find enough to get by if it’s just the basics you need.

Onward Travel Options from Didcot Parkway

Didcot Parkway stands as a connective node linking passengers to various transportation modes. The station forecourt houses the rail replacement service, and a taxi rank is available at the station entrance, providing easy access for those who might need it. If cycling is more your style, Brompton Bike Hire services offer bicycles just outside the station—ideal for environmentally conscious travelers or those looking to navigate around the local area at their own pace.

Bus services have got you covered, with information available to help plan your journey. For airport connections, changing at Reading will link you to Heathrow and Gatwick, facilitating easy transitions from train to plane.

Station Facilities and Customer Service

Wylde Green Station ensures convenient travel with well-positioned ticket machines for quick and easy interactions. While the ticket office is open at varying hours throughout the week, the move towards digital efficiency means online ticket collections can be smoothly handled at the station’s ticket machines. Accessibility features prominent here, with induction loops and ramps to aid differently-abled travellers in navigating the station. While it lacks the luxury of waiting rooms or on-site amenities like shops and refreshment facilities, the staff's presence and comprehensive customer information systems warmly compensate for this, offering a helping hand whenever needed—a testament to the station's commitment to excellence in service.

Onward Travel Options

Transitioning from rail to other modes of transport in Wylde Green is straightforward. Taxis are readily available, with local operators such as Sutton Radio and Parkers just a call away. For those days when rail services face disruptions, a reliable rail replacement service can get you moving again, departing from the front of the station. Furthermore, bus links are accessible, making Wylde Green a critical junction for further travel.
